Comprehensive Guide to Charitable Appraisal Report

What is the Noncash Charitable Contribution Appraisal Report?

The Noncash Charitable Contribution Appraisal Report is a crucial document that establishes the fair market value of donated property for income tax deduction purposes. This report plays a significant role in tax deduction processes, ensuring that both donors and the IRS have a clear understanding of the property's value. Included in the appraisal report are essential components such as the fair market value, the details of the donated property, and the certification by a qualified appraiser.

Purpose and Benefits of the Noncash Charitable Contribution Appraisal Report

Individuals require the Noncash Charitable Contribution Appraisal Report for various tax purposes, primarily to substantiate the value of their charitable donations. The benefits of having a certified appraisal extend beyond just compliance; it also enhances credibility with tax authorities, ensuring that charitable donations are accurately reported. An IRS qualified appraisal can offer peace of mind to the donor by verifying their claims to tax deductions.

Who Needs the Noncash Charitable Contribution Appraisal Report?

The primary audience for the Noncash Charitable Contribution Appraisal Report includes individuals donating noncash assets, such as collectibles, real estate, or vehicles. Additionally, stakeholders like non-profit organizations can benefit, as they may need to verify the values of donations made to them internally or for their records. Understanding the need for accurate personal property appraisals is essential for anyone involved in charitable giving.

When to Use the Noncash Charitable Contribution Appraisal Report

There are specific scenarios in which utilizing the Noncash Charitable Contribution Appraisal Report is necessary. These include situations where:
  • The donor intends to claim a tax deduction for a noncash donation
  • The donation exceeds a certain fair market value threshold set by the IRS
It is also crucial to consider the timeline for submission, particularly during tax filing seasons, to ensure compliance with IRS requirements.
